WebAdditional Notes for Clients Using the Reduced Intraday Margin Rate. The day trade rate is valid from 9:00 a.m. until 4 p.m. ET Monday through Friday, for U.S. Equity Index Futures, as well as select Currency, Energy, Metals, and Interest Rate contracts. A valid stop order* is required at all times when utilizing the day trade rate.

WebFeb 22, 2024 · Non-marginable securities typically include of exotic stock, or those considered high risk, perhaps because of low liquidity and higher levels of volatility. That can include stocks that trade over-the-counter (OTC), or penny stocks ( valued at less than $5 per share). It may also include IPO stocks. In general, securities held in an IRA or a ...
